Am doing a snowshoe hare and am wondering the best way to preserve the ears and keep them erect. They seem too thin turn inside out like normal deer ears. Any help would be appreciated. Thanks guys and gals.

Matt,
I have found that turning them is the only way to go. If you take your time they really are not that bad. I then tan the hide and use bondo to set the ears. Be sure to card them or they will have a tendancy to curl. If you tear the ear they are easy to repair with a dry sheet. Good luck.

for my experience, turning hare hears is esyest if you salt for a night the skin then turn the ears, the ears skin looks more resistent after salting
